Is color Doppler ultrasonography reliable in diagnosing adnexal torsion? A large cohort analysis

Abstract

Introduction

Color Doppler ultrasonography (CDU) is widely used to diagnose adnexal torsion (AT). However, its validity remains questionable due to its low sensitivity. Our study aimed to evaluate the accuracy of CDU for the preoperative diagnosis of AT.

Material and methods

The electronic medical records of patients who were taken to the operating room with the diagnosis of suspected AT were reviewed. Patients having surgically/pathologically-proven AT were compared with patients who were found to have a different pathology at the time of surgery. CDU validity was assessed using a 2 × 2 table and compared with a diagnostic model that consists of the Doppler findings, patient’s age, and previous surgical history.

Results

AT was diagnosed correctly in 74.6% of cases. Absent Doppler flow was seen in only 18.6% of cases. Although its specificity and positive predictive value were high, CDU had very low sensitivity and negative predictive value. The combined diagnostic model exceeded CDU alone in terms of diagnostic accuracy.

Conclusions

The use of CDU alone is not a reliable modality to exclude AT. Absent Doppler flow is a sign of ovarian necrosis. Clinical correlation between CDU findings and the patient’s symptoms makes the diagnosis of AT more timely and accurate.
